The Principal Consulting Engineer drives Nokia's solutions in the IP Routing and Data Center Fabric portfolio and supports pre-sales teams with deep product and technology knowledge, competitive intelligence and winning strategies through consultative selling approach to maximize Nokia's portfolio adoption. Delivers business consulting services (tactical & strategic business cases) articulating Nokia's solutions with an inclusive customer engagement plan and effective interaction with customer decision makers to justify their strategy and investments.
You will be required to be responsive to the needs of our customers and their sales teams acting as their trusted advisor for the IP products and solutions. You must have a strong technical background, a clear understanding of the sales process, be completely self-motivated and able to operate in an independent manner with minimal supervision. You will often be in the position to drive required next steps toward technical acceptance of Nokia solutions with customers directly or via the systems engineering teams.
Four-year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ering/Computer Science (or related technical degree and/or equivalent experience)
· Minimum 10+ years of experience as a customer facing technical pre-sales engineer working with Hyperscaler and Cloud companies, or equivalent experience designing and/or operating IP networks at Hyperscaler and Cloud companies
· Experience working in a technical leadership role, developing and implementing programs involving multiple stakeholders
· Deep conceptual understanding and testing and deployment experience of the following technologies:
o IPv4 and IPv6 Routing technologies including IGP (OSPF and IS-IS) and BGP
o Layer 2 and Layer 3 VPN technologies including MPLS, Segment Routing (with MPLS and IPv6 data plane), VXLAN, Pseudowires, VPLS, EVPN, and IP VPNs
o Traffic Engineering including RSVP-TE, SR-TE and PCE/PCEP architectures
o Modern Data Center networking design and operations including CLOS networks, Underlay and Overlay technologies, and the networking integration to cloud and virtualization platforms
o YANG models (proprietary and standards), Open Config, NETCONF, gNMI Telemetry and modern network automation frameworks
o Familiarity with designing and implementing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) practices
· Good understanding of the current networking chipset options both in the Data Center and in the WAN
· Must have the following Product Development skills:
o Experience driving product lifecycle management requirements
o Ability to write detailed “Feature Request Documents” describing all the detailed software and hardware requirements for new feature development
o Ability to build credible business and technical arguments, including low-level technical discussions on HW and SW, to support feature development requests
o Ability to understand different HW platforms and their capabilities down to the chipset level to drive product evolution discussions
o Be on top of industry standardization entities like IETF, contributing to emerging standards as require

Work closely with the sales teams (sales executives, sales managers, sales engineers) on identifying opportunities and driving IP business to closure.
-
Develop the technical strategy for each opportunity with the sales team and drive it to technical acceptance by the customer.
-
Be able to meet with influential customer decision makers and communicate verbally or via presentation tools the exact details of Nokia’s IP product capabilities and the specific solutions being offered to the customer.
-
Develop technical collateral, such as white papers and PowerPoint presentations to demonstrate to customers how Nokia’s products and delivery capabilities are their best option for success.
-
Work with Product Line Managers Drive to drive product development through customer and industry specific feedback based on current and future requirements.
